Five Brits have made it onto the shortlist of 100 candidates for the Mars One Project, which aims to create a permanent human settlement on the red planet by 2024.
The privately funded project, which is expected to cost six billion dollars, is already lined up to provide the backdrop for a new reality television series.
There were more than 200,000 applicants for the one-way trip. These have been whittled down to a final 100, including three British physics and astrophysics research students, a lab technician and a manager for Virgin Media …. http://rt.com
